Abstract

1471335 Analyzing flue gases photo-electrically BAILEY METER CO 9 April 1974 [9 April 1973] 15666/74 Heading G1A In an apparatus for analyzing a flowing gas in a duct, a slotted pipe 6, Fig. 1, extends across the duct between a radiation source 18 and a detector 20; the gas passes through the slotted pipe, and the radiation absorbed by the gas is measured. A purging gas, e.g. air, is blown into each end of the slotted tube via inlets 21, 22 and apertured discs 24, 26, this gas serving to define a flow of the gas being measured and also to keep the optical elements of the measuring system clean. The slotted tube 6 is typically 4" diameter, and may have internal reinforcements, Figs. 2, 4 (not shown). The apertured discs have holes 2" or less and the minimum air flow-rate for consistent measurements is about 2.5 s.c.f.m. per inch of aperture diameter. The discs may have their upper regions angled away from the flow of gas to be measured, Fig. 3 (not shown).
